Former CFO Of California Firm Charged With Embezzling More Than $1.9 Million

Salvatory Josef Fulwider, 36, of Yorba Linda, was arrested and charged last month with embezzling more than $1.9 million from McLarand Vasquez Emsiek & Partners, a local architectural firm where he had been employed as CFO. According to prosecutors, Fulwider transferred some $1.3 million out of one of the firm's partners' accounts and also received over $680,000 in fraudulent reimbursements from the firm. He has been charged with 2 counts of grand theft, 9 counts of forgery and 37 counts of falsifying records. Fulwider's scheme spanned at least 4 years.
